What are the biggest challenges in last mile delivery?

The biggest challenges in last mile delivery revolve around cost, efficiency, and customer experience. These include high transportation costs associated with delivering single packages to individual addresses, the complexity of route optimization in dense urban environments or sprawling rural areas, and meeting increasingly demanding customer expectations for speed, flexibility, and transparency.

Last mile delivery faces a unique set of hurdles that contribute to its high cost, often representing over 50% of the total shipping expenses. These costs are driven by factors like fuel, driver wages, vehicle maintenance, and the inefficiencies inherent in delivering to multiple, geographically dispersed locations. Optimizing routes to minimize travel time and distance is crucial, but this is complicated by unpredictable traffic, construction, and the dynamic nature of delivery schedules (e.g., last-minute order changes). Furthermore, failed deliveries due to inaccurate addresses, absent recipients, or lack of secure delivery locations exacerbate the problem, leading to additional expenses and customer dissatisfaction. Meeting ever-rising customer expectations presents another significant challenge. Customers now demand same-day or even on-demand delivery, real-time tracking, and flexible delivery options (e.g., specific time windows, alternative delivery locations). Meeting these expectations requires sophisticated technology, including advanced routing software, GPS tracking, and communication platforms to keep customers informed. Companies must also invest in flexible delivery options, such as partnerships with local couriers or the implementation of locker systems, to cater to diverse customer needs and preferences. Ultimately, overcoming these hurdles requires a multi-faceted approach involving technological innovation, optimized logistics, and a customer-centric strategy.

How does technology impact last mile delivery efficiency?

Technology significantly enhances last mile delivery efficiency by optimizing routes, automating processes, providing real-time visibility, and improving communication, ultimately reducing costs and improving customer satisfaction.

Technology addresses many challenges inherent in last mile delivery, such as high costs, delivery delays, and complex logistics. Route optimization software, powered by sophisticated algorithms, analyzes traffic patterns, weather conditions, and delivery schedules to determine the most efficient routes for delivery vehicles. This minimizes mileage, fuel consumption, and delivery time. Automation, through the use of tools like automated dispatch systems and package tracking, streamlines operations and reduces manual errors, freeing up personnel to focus on more complex tasks. Real-time visibility, enabled by GPS tracking and mobile communication devices, allows dispatchers and customers to monitor the location of delivery vehicles and packages in real-time. This transparency builds trust and allows for proactive intervention in case of delays or unexpected issues. Finally, technology facilitates seamless communication between dispatchers, drivers, and customers. Mobile apps allow drivers to receive updated instructions, report issues, and confirm deliveries electronically, while customers can receive notifications about delivery status and communicate directly with the delivery service if needed. What is the cost breakdown of last mile delivery?

The cost breakdown of last mile delivery typically includes transportation (vehicle and fuel), labor (driver wages and benefits), technology (routing software and tracking systems), and administrative overhead (customer service and management). Transportation and labor usually account for the largest portions, often exceeding 50-70% of the total cost, with technology and administrative expenses splitting the remaining percentage.

Expanding on this, transportation costs encompass vehicle depreciation, maintenance, fuel, and insurance. The type of vehicle used (e.g., van, truck, bicycle) significantly influences these expenses. Labor costs include driver salaries, benefits, training, and potential overtime. These expenses are often affected by local wage laws and the difficulty of finding and retaining qualified drivers. Technology costs cover the software and hardware used to optimize routes, track deliveries, and manage customer communication. While a significant investment, technology can improve efficiency and reduce overall costs in the long run. Administrative overhead includes customer service, order management, warehouse operations related to sorting and staging orders for delivery, and general management expenses. These costs are often spread across the entire organization but a portion is directly attributable to the last mile process. Effective management and optimization in each of these areas are crucial for minimizing last mile delivery expenses.

How do companies optimize their last mile delivery strategy?

Companies optimize their last mile delivery strategy by focusing on efficiency, cost reduction, and customer satisfaction. This involves leveraging technology for route optimization, implementing real-time tracking, utilizing various delivery methods (including in-house fleets, third-party logistics providers, and crowdsourced delivery), and strategically locating fulfillment centers to minimize delivery distances. Ultimately, the goal is to provide fast, reliable, and affordable delivery options that meet evolving customer expectations.

To achieve these goals, businesses often implement sophisticated software solutions that analyze traffic patterns, weather conditions, and delivery density to dynamically adjust routes and schedules. These systems can also provide customers with accurate estimated delivery times (ETAs) and real-time updates on the location of their packages. Furthermore, optimizing the last mile also involves streamlining warehouse operations to ensure efficient order fulfillment and minimizing delays in the initial stages of the delivery process. Another critical aspect of optimization is the careful selection of delivery methods. Companies may choose to maintain their own delivery fleets for greater control, partner with established logistics providers for scalability and broader geographic reach, or utilize crowdsourced delivery platforms for flexibility during peak demand periods. A hybrid approach, combining different delivery methods based on factors like order size, delivery distance, and urgency, can often be the most effective. Finally, customer satisfaction is paramount. Providing convenient delivery options, such as scheduled deliveries, lockers, or in-store pickup, along with proactive communication and easy returns, helps to build loyalty and positive brand perception.

What are the environmental impacts of last mile delivery?

Last mile delivery, the final step in the supply chain involving the transportation of goods from a distribution hub to the end customer, has significant environmental impacts, primarily stemming from increased greenhouse gas emissions, air and noise pollution, and packaging waste.

The high volume of individual deliveries, often concentrated in urban areas, results in a proliferation of delivery vehicles on roads. These vehicles, frequently powered by fossil fuels, contribute substantially to carbon dioxide (CO2) and other harmful emissions, exacerbating climate change. Stop-and-go traffic, common in last mile delivery routes, reduces fuel efficiency and increases emissions compared to longer, more consistent journeys. Furthermore, the increasing demand for faster delivery times encourages the use of smaller vehicles, which, while potentially more maneuverable, often have lower fuel economy per package delivered compared to larger, consolidated shipments.

Beyond greenhouse gas emissions, last mile delivery contributes to air and noise pollution, particularly in densely populated areas. The exhaust fumes from delivery vehicles release particulate matter and nitrogen oxides, which are detrimental to human health, causing respiratory problems and other health issues. The constant noise of delivery vehicles, including idling engines and frequent stops, disrupts the peace and quiet of residential neighborhoods. Finally, the packaging required to protect goods during transit generates a significant amount of waste, much of which ends up in landfills. While efforts are being made to promote sustainable packaging options, the sheer volume of packages remains a challenge.

How is customer experience tied to last mile delivery?

Customer experience is intrinsically linked to last mile delivery because it's the final touchpoint in the purchasing journey, and often the most memorable. A positive last mile experience, characterized by speed, reliability, transparency, and convenience, builds customer loyalty and encourages repeat purchases. Conversely, issues like late deliveries, damaged goods, poor communication, or inconvenient delivery options can lead to dissatisfaction, negative reviews, and lost business.

The last mile is where the digital meets the physical world for the customer. After a carefully curated online experience, a seamless and efficient delivery solidifies the positive perception of the brand. Customers now expect real-time tracking, accurate estimated delivery times, and flexible delivery options that fit their schedules. Meeting and exceeding these expectations through reliable and communicative last mile services is crucial for building trust and satisfaction.

Furthermore, the delivery person becomes a representative of the brand during the last mile. Their professionalism, courtesy, and ability to handle unexpected situations can significantly impact the customer's overall perception. A friendly and helpful delivery driver can turn a potentially negative situation, like a slightly delayed delivery, into a positive interaction. Therefore, investing in training and equipping delivery personnel with the tools to provide excellent customer service is a key aspect of optimizing the last mile experience.
